Is Your Hair Trying to Tell You Something? Signs It’s Time for a Refresh
We’re great at ignoring subtle signs—especially when it comes to our hair. Life gets busy, appointments get pushed, and suddenly your hair doesn’t feel like you anymore. The truth is, your hair is always communicating… and when it’s unhappy, it shows.
If your hair has been feeling “off” lately, it might be time for a refresh. Here are some common signs your hair is ready for a little extra attention—and what to do about it.
One of the biggest clues is dullness. When hair loses its shine, it’s often a sign of dryness, buildup, or faded color. Healthy hair reflects light easily, while dehydrated hair tends to look flat and lifeless. A gloss, deep conditioning treatment, or a reset to your at-home routine can bring that shine right back.
Another sign is styling fatigue. If your hair suddenly feels harder to style, won’t hold a curl, or takes longer to blow-dry, it may be dealing with damage or product buildup. When hair health declines, styling becomes frustrating—and that’s your cue that something needs to change.
Split ends and breakage are another way your hair asks for help. Even if you’re being gentle, dryness and weakened bonds can cause ends to fray. This doesn’t always mean you need a major haircut, but it does mean your hair could benefit from a trim, bond-repair treatment, or extra moisture support.
Color changes can also be a clear signal. If your balayage looks brassy, your brunette feels flat, or your blonde has lost its brightness, your hair may be asking for a gloss or toner refresh. These subtle services can make a noticeable difference without committing to a full color appointment.
Your scalp can send signals too. Dryness, flaking, excess oil, or itchiness often indicate buildup or imbalance. A professional scalp detox or exfoliation treatment can reset your foundation and improve how your hair looks and feels from root to tip.
Sometimes the sign is simply that your hair no longer matches how you feel. A refresh doesn’t have to mean a drastic transformation—it can be as simple as face-framing highlights, layers, a gloss, or adjusting your routine to better fit your lifestyle.
Listening to your hair early helps prevent bigger fixes later. Small, intentional updates keep your hair healthy, manageable, and aligned with the version of you you want to show up as.
